Chinese auto industry and Zhongxing brand

The main representative of the automotive industry starting with the letter β€œZ” is the company Zhongxing, also known by the acronym ZX Auto. It is one of the oldest Chinese automakers, founded back in 1949, making its history comparable to many European giants. For a long time, the company specialized in the production of military equipment and light trucks before moving on to the production of civilian SUVs and pickup trucks. Today, the model range includes both utilitarian commercial versions and comfortable SUVs for urban use.

The brand's technical philosophy is based on the use of proven, although not always modern, units. Engines are often based on licensed copies of Mitsubishi engines or developments of in-house engineering bureaus, adapted for low fuel quality. Frame design Most models provide high cross-country ability, but have a negative impact on fuel efficiency and comfort of movement on asphalt roads. The suspension is tuned to perform in harsh conditions, making these vehicles popular in rural areas and on construction sites.

⚠️ Attention: When purchasing a used ZX Auto or a similar brand with the letter Z, be sure to check the condition of the frame for corrosion, since the quality of anti-corrosion treatment on early models left much to be desired.

Technical features of rare Chinese SUVs

Considering the technical aspects of cars of brands starting with the letter β€œF”, in particular modern Chinese SUVs, one cannot help but note their design simplicity. The internal combustion engines installed on these models often have a volume of 2.0 to 2.8 liters and are equipped with turbocharging to compensate for the low degree of boost. Motor life directly depends on the quality of the oil used and its replacement intervals, which are recommended to be reduced to 7-8 thousand kilometers in urban use.

Transmissions in such cars are either classic manual gearboxes or automatic torque converters of older series. Robotic gearboxes are less common and often cause complaints about clutch reliability. Four-wheel drive, as a rule, connected (Part-Time), which requires the driver to understand the physics of the process and (prohibits) the inclusion of all-wheel drive on hard surfaces in order to avoid damage to the transfer case.

  • πŸš— Engine: Technologies developed 10-15 years ago are often used, which ensures maintainability but high fuel consumption.
  • βš™οΈ Suspension: Dependent rear suspension on leaf springs or springs, designed for high load capacity rather than comfort.
  • πŸ›‘οΈ Body: The presence of a spar-type frame to which the main units are attached, providing torsional strength.
  • πŸ”Œ Electrical: Simple wiring with a minimum amount of electronic β€œnonsense”, which reduces the risk of failures, but limits functionality.

Particular attention should be paid to the cooling system, which works efficiently in the hot climates for which these cars were often designed, but can overheat in traffic jams. Thermostats and radiators require regular cleaning and inspection. Owners are recommended to install additional temperature sensors and, if necessary, replace standard fans with more efficient analogues.

Problems with spare parts and service logistics

The main difficulty for the owner of a rare car is providing it with vital components. If for popular models Toyota or Volkswagen There are spare parts in every store, but for the rare β€œChinese” the situation is different. Spare parts catalogs may not be updated for years, and the VIN code is not always entered correctly in international databases. This forces owners to rely on direct deliveries from dealers or searching for analogues at disassembly sites.

Body parts such as bumpers, headlights and fenders are the most vulnerable in the event of an accident. Finding them can take months, so experienced owners recommend immediately after purchase to find a β€œdonor” at a disassembly site or purchase a body kit. Glasses and optics also belong to the category of scarce goods that are incompatible with other models.

⚠️ Warning: Do not attempt to install universal parts without carefully checking the dimensions and fastenings. Rare brand designs often have unique attachment points that differ from the standard ones.

The situation is saved by a developed network of suppliers from China working through online platforms. However, it is important to know the exact name of the part in English or Chinese. Search by photo often turns out to be more effective than searching by article. It is also worth considering customs duties and delivery times, which can vary from two weeks to two months.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)

Are there official dealers of brands starting with the letter Z in Russia?

At the moment, the Zhongxing (ZX Auto) brand has practically no official dealer network in Russia. Cars are imported by private dealers or purchased on the secondary market. Service must be carried out at universal service stations specializing in Chinese cars.

How reliable are the engines of these cars?

The engines are considered quite reliable due to their simple design and low boost level. However, they are sensitive to the quality of fuel and oil. With timely maintenance, the engine life can exceed 300-400 thousand kilometers.

Is it possible to find spare parts for these machines in regular stores?

Consumables (filters, pads) are often suitable from other popular models (for example, Toyota or Isuzu), but specific parts (bodywork, suspension elements) are only available to order through online stores or suppliers from China.

Why are these cars so cheap on the secondary market?

The main reason for the rapid drop in price is low liquidity and difficulties with spare parts. Buyers fear service problems, which reduces demand. However, for a knowledgeable person, this is an opportunity to buy a marketable SUV for little money.
